Build Quality and Mechanical Design – Linear Rail + Lead Screw Hybrid System

The most important upgrade in the 3018 Pro Ultra CNC router is its motion system design.

Unlike standard entry-level 3018 CNC machines that rely solely on lead screws with V-wheel or rod-based guidance, this model introduces a lead screw drive system combined with an X-axis linear rail. This hybrid structure improves motion stability during cutting and reduces vibration during directional changes.

While it does not use a ball screw system, the addition of a linear guide significantly increases axis rigidity compared to traditional 3018 CNC router designs. In real machining conditions, this results in more consistent toolpaths during extended carving sessions, where lower-end machines typically begin to lose precision.

The reinforced aluminum frame further improves structural stability, particularly in wood cutting and light metal engraving tasks. Setup Experience and GRBL CNC Software Compatibility

The 3018 Pro Ultra runs on a GRBL-based CNC control system, ensuring broad compatibility with widely used CNC software such as Fusion 360, Universal G-code Sender (UGS), and LightBurn.

Assembly is straightforward, as the machine arrives partially pre-assembled with clearly labeled wiring. Most users can complete setup and calibration within a few hours, making it suitable for beginners entering the CNC router workflow.

Light Metal CNC Machining (Aluminum Testing)

Metal machining is typically the weakest point for any 3018 CNC router, and aluminum was used as the benchmark material for real-world testing.

With conservative machining settings such as shallow depth passes, reduced feed rates, and proper lubrication, the 3018 Pro Ultra is capable of stable light aluminum cutting. Toolpaths remain consistent during operation, and dimensional accuracy is maintained across repeated machining cycles.

Although it is not designed for aggressive metal removal, its improved rigidity and guided motion system provide more stable results compared to standard lead-screw-only CNC routers.

CNC Comparison – Lunyee 3018 Pro Ultra vs Genmitsu 3018 PROVer V2

Category

Lunyee 3018 Pro Ultra

Genmitsu 3018 PROVer V2

Work Area

300 × 180 × 80 mm

290 × 180 × 40 mm

Frame Structure

Aluminum & steel rail structure

Aluminum frame + plastic carriage system

Motion System

X-axis linear rail + T8 lead screw

T8 lead screw + rod guide system

Spindle Power

500W spindle

775 DC motor (~120W class)

Spindle Speed

Up to 12,000 RPM

Up to 9,000–10,000 RPM

Controller

32-bit GRBL controller

32-bit GRBL 1.1h

Max Speed

~5000 mm/min

~2000 mm/min

Precision

±0.1 mm

~±0.1–0.2 mm

Metal Capability

Light aluminum machining

Basic engraving only

Software

GRBL Firmware, e.g. Easel, Candle,UGS, Fusion360, LaserGRBL, LightBurn

Candle / UGS / LightBurn

Weight

14kg

~8.2 kg

This comparison highlights the key difference: improved mechanical guidance directly enhances machining stability, especially in long-duration CNC jobs and light metal cutting scenarios.

Cons

• Limited working area compared to larger CNC systems

• Not suitable for heavy-duty industrial metal machining

• Lead screw system still has inherent backlash compared to ball screw designs
